    So these have to be line of sight? My property is heavy brush

    • @midwestmtnoutdoors
      @midwestmtnoutdoors  3 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      Not quite but connection distance between them will vary depending on elevation and thickness. I have some that are 700 yards apart across high pastures and others that are 200 yards apart through cedar swamp.

    Can the main camera be connected to your home WiFi so you don't have to pay for a cellular plan

    • @midwestmtnoutdoors
      @midwestmtnoutdoors  9 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      I haven’t seen that offered yet. But, you could always use the Cuddeback system as it was originally designed: Forget the cellcam portion - set one camera as “Home” nearby your house, cottage, etc, set all other cameras as remote (like in my video) and go frequently pull the home cam SD card to check activity from all the remote cams; no cell data plan needed
